Welcome to the next episode of "Stories of Our Skin," a podcast series by the GLODERM Trainee Committee, supported by CeraVe Care For All. Join hosts Sidra Khan and Aakaash Varma as they engage in a profound conversation with Rick Guidotti, an acclaimed fashion photographer and the founder of Positive Exposure. In this episode, Rick shares his journey from high fashion to advocating for people with visible differences, and how his work has redefined beauty standards around the world. His story is one of empathy, empowerment, and celebrating the richness of human diversity.Key HighlightsIntroduction to the Podcast: Sidra and Aakaash introduce the podcast series and its objectives.Guest Background: Overview of Rick Guidotti’s career as a fashion photographer and his transition into advocacy.Personal Journey: Rick shares his inspiring journey from high fashion to founding Positive Exposure.Redefining Beauty: Discussion on how Rick’s work challenges traditional beauty standards and celebrates diversity.Impactful Experiences: Memorable moments from Rick’s work, including his interactions with individuals and families.Current Projects: An overview of Positive Exposure’s ongoing initiatives and collaborations with global advocacy groups.Role of Photography and Art: How photography can be a powerful tool for social change and reducing stigma.Future Goals: Rick’s vision for the future of Positive Exposure and his continued efforts to make a difference.Audience Engagement: Call to action for listeners to join the conversation on Twitter.As we wrap up this episode, we hope Rick Guidotti’s journey of redefining beauty and celebrating human diversity has been both enlightening and inspiring.Find out more about Rick's work at Positive Exposure: https://positiveexposure.org/Stay tuned for more episodes where we dive deeper into critical issues and advancements in dermatology, bringing expert perspectives and real stories to light.
